一种拼接式提醒装置,至少包括两块模块件,任一模块件至少设置有一个对接部(2),模块件的对接部(2)能与另一模块件的对接部(2)配对对接连接,当模块件的对接部(2)与另一模块件的对接部(2)对接时彼此同时电导通连接和/或数据导通和/或信号导通连接,其中至少一块模块件为能够通过具体事件以触发产生提醒的屏显模块(3)。该装置的优点在于结构简单,且可以根据自己的喜爱和需求选择不同数量的模块进行自由拼接。

种拼接式提醒装置 技术领域
[0001] 本发明涉及一种拼接式提醒装置。
背景技术
[0002] 随着现代社会的发展, 人们的生活节奏越来越快, 需要记录的信息和事件也越 来越多, 为了让工作和生活更有效率, 使用各种各样的终端设备 (例如: 手机 或智能手表等) 来记录和提醒日程成为用户广泛的需求。 然而在一些场景中, 提醒事件的提醒方式是不确定的, 例如: 提醒事件为出门之前倒垃圾, 然而出 门之前的时间无法预先确定, 无法有效的提醒用户执行这类时间不确定的提醒 事件。
[0003] 为了解决上述的问题, 人们将一些提醒装置放置在门口或家里的其它位置, 当 出门这一事件发生时, 会通过相关装置激发提醒装置而发布提醒。 只是, 现有 的提醒装置的放置及布置不尽人意。

[0028] 为了使本领域的技术人员更好地理解本发明的技术方案, 下面结合附图和实施 例对本发明作进一步的详细说明。
[0029] 如附图 1至附图 4所示的一种拼接式提醒装置, 包括有四块模块件 (实际上, 在 具体使用时, 人们可以根据自己的喜爱和需求选择不同数量的模块件进行自由 拼接而无限拓展) , 任一模块件均设置有六个对接部 2, 即各所述模块件可以设 计为六棱柱结构, 当然, 模块件可以设置成其它诸如三棱柱、 四棱柱等棱柱状 结构。
[0030] 模块件的每一个侧面设置所述对接部 2。 模块件的对接部 2能与另一模块件的对 接部 2配对对接连接, 当模块件的对接部 2与另一模块件的对接部 2对接时彼此同 时电导通连接和/或数据导通和 /或信号导通连接, 其中一块模块件为能够通过具 体事件以触发产生提醒的屏显模块 3。
[0031] 为了使模块件与模块件能拼接在一起, 所述对接部 2设置有磁吸装置 21, 当模 块件与另一模块件拼接时, 对应的磁吸装置 21相互吸附。 当然, 磁吸装置 21也 可以更换成卡扣结构而实现模块件的拼接。 所述对接部 2至少有两个而分为公头 对接部 22和母头对接部 23 , 公头对接部 22设置有磁铁, 母头对接部 23对应公头 对接部 22之磁铁极性而设置可与其相吸附的磁铁。
[0032] 公头对接部 22和母头对接部 23设置有供磁铁放置的容置腔 24, 容置腔 24中固定 设置磁铁, 公头对接部 22和母头对接部 23中的一个的磁铁向对接部 2外部伸出, 公头对接部 22和母头对接部 23中的另一个的磁铁向对接部 2内部陷入, 模块件与 模块件对接时, 向对接部 2外部伸出的磁铁伸进磁铁向对接部 2内部陷入对应的 容置腔 24中。
[0033] 公头对接部 22设置有可用于传送电流、 信号或数据的公电连接件 221, 母头对 接部 23设置有可用于传送电流、 信号或数据的母电连接件 231, 模块件与模块件 对接时, 公电连接件 221插入母电连接件 231中。
[0034] 如附图 5和附图 6所示, 所述屏显模块 3具有显示器 31、 处理器 32、 发送器和接 收器,所述接收器用以接收具体事件而向处理器 32传送信号, 处理器 32处理信号 后向发送器发送指示而在所述显示器 31上显示提醒。
[0035] 所述屏显模块 3还包括扬声器 33 ; 所述处理器 32还用于通过所述扬声器 33发出 声音提醒, 以及通过语音的方式播报提醒。
[0036] 公电连接件 221和母电连接件 231为 5PIN可相互磁吸数据电源接口。
[0037] 如附图 7和附图 8所示, 拼接式提醒装置中可以选用其中至少一块模块件为用于 为移动设备进行无线充电的充电模块 4。 其具有一充电盒体 41, 充电盒体 41设置 有无线充电组件 42,无线充电组件 42包括有设置在充电盒体 41内的 QI发射端和隔 磁片线圈。 所述充电盒体 41上还设置有用以吸附移动装置的吸附装置 43 , 所述 吸附装置 43为设置在充电盒体 41内的磁铁。
[0038] 如附图 9和附图 10所示, 拼接式提醒装置中可以选用其中至少一块模块件为吸 附物件的磁吸模块 5, 其具有一磁吸盒体 51, 磁吸盒体 51设置有磁吸组件 52, 磁 吸模块 5设置有射频读卡器 53。
[0039] 充电模块 4与外部电源电连接, 充电模块 4接接到屏显模块 3时, 充电模块 4的对 接部 2与屏显模块 3的对接部 2对接, 充电模块 4所需电源由屏显模块 3经公电连接 件 221和母电连接件 231后进入隔磁片线圈。 磁吸模块 5接接到屏显模块 3时, 射 频读卡器 53通过公电连接件 221和母电连接件 231与屏显模块 3的处理器 32连接, 当人们使用带有 NFC卡的金属部件 (诸如钥匙) 通过磁吸模块 5的磁吸组件 52被 \¥0 2019/128267 卩(:17(:\2018/102002 磁吸到磁吸模块 5上时,
NFC卡在射频读卡器 53的感应范围内, 射频读卡器 53与 NFC卡建立通信连接并将 信号送到处理器 32后而在所述显示屏上显示提醒。
